Top 5 Simulator Games in Mexico Q2 2022

During the second quarter of 2022, the top 5 simulator games in Mexico demonstrated varied performance in terms of downloads, revenue, and active users. Here’s a detailed look at each game’s metrics:

Makeup Master - Fashion Girl from Tap Q Games saw weekly downloads peak at approximately 204.8K in mid-April, followed by a gradual decline to around 41.3K by the end of June. Weekly revenue for the game peaked at $50 in early May but showed fluctuations, ending the quarter with $12. Active users mirrored the download trend, peaking at 285.3K in mid-April and declining to about 106K by the end of June.

Deliver It 3D from Voodoo experienced a significant increase in weekly downloads, reaching 249.8K in early May before declining to around 31.9K by the end of June. Weekly revenue for the game peaked at $59 in early May and then saw a drop to $20 by the end of June. Active users peaked at 479.2K in early May and gradually decreased to approximately 248.7K by the end of the quarter.

Airport Security: Fly Safe by Kwalee Ltd saw a steady decline in weekly downloads from a peak of 225.2K at the end of March to around 43.3K by the end of June. Weekly revenue for the game peaked at $98 in late April but dropped to $41 by the end of June. Active users decreased from 401K at the end of March to about 203.1K by the end of June.

Solar Smash from PARADYME LIMITED showed a peak in weekly downloads at approximately 86K in late April, followed by a decline to around 35.4K by the end of June. The game’s weekly revenue peaked at $71 in early May, with fluctuations ending at $28 by the end of June. Active users peaked at 414.6K in late May and gradually declined to about 261.7K by the end of the quarter.

Sculpt People from Crazy Labs experienced a peak in weekly downloads of around 84.5K in early May, followed by a decline to about 57K by the end of June. Active users for the game peaked at 196.6K in early May and showed a decline to approximately 159K by the end of June.
